.SH "EXIT STATUS"
|
||||
Normally, the exit status is 0. If emacsclient shuts down due to
|
||||
Emacs signaling an error, the exit status is 1.
|
||||
.SH ENVIRONMENT
|
||||
.TP
|
||||
.B ALTERNATE_EDITOR
|
||||
If the Emacs server is not running, run the shell command in this
|
||||
environment variable instead. If set to the empty string, run
|
||||
"emacs \-\-daemon" to start Emacs in daemon mode, and try to connect
|
||||
to it. Will be overridden by the
|
||||
.B \-\-alternate-editor
|
||||
option, if present.
|
||||
.TP
|
||||
.B EMACSCLIENT_TRAMP
|
||||
A prefix to add to filenames, intended to allow Emacs to locate files
|
||||
on remote machines using TRAMP. Will be overridden by the
|
||||
.B \-\-tramp
|
||||
option, if present.
|
||||
.TP
|
||||
.B EMACS_SERVER_FILE
|
||||
Look in this file to discover where to find a TCP Emacs server.
|
||||
Relative filenames are relative to "~/.emacs.d/server/" or
|
||||
"$XDG_CONFIG_HOME/emacs/server/", and the
|
||||
default is "server". Will be overridden by the
|
||||
.B \-\-server-file
|
||||
option, if present.
|
||||
.TP
|
||||
.B EMACS_SOCKET_NAME
|
||||
The filename of the socket to use for communication with the Emacs server.
|
||||
Relative filenames are relative to "$XDG_RUNTIME_DIR/emacs/" or "$TMPDIR/".
|
||||
Will be overridden by the
|
||||
.B \-\-socket-name
|
||||
option, if present.
